Béla Hegedüs is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Organic Chemistry and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ging. According to data from OpenAlex, Béla Hegedüs has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 366 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Molecular Biology, 3 papers in Organic Chemistry and 3 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ging. Recurrent topics in Béla Hegedüs’s work include Infrared Thermography in Medicine (3 papers),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(3 papers) and Chemical Thermodynamics and Molecular Structure (2 papers). Béla Hegedüs is often cited by papers focused on Infrared Thermography in Medicine (3 papers),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(3 papers) and Chemical Thermodynamics and Molecular Structure (2 papers). Béla Hegedüs collaborates with scholars based in Hungary. Béla Hegedüs's co-authors include Márta Gálfi, Sándor Gǒrög, Gábor K. Tóth, Mátyás Fekete, Gyula Telegdy, Botond Penke, Alajos Kálmán, Orsolya Egyed, László Pa̋rkányi and Sándor Holly and has published in prestigious journals such as European Journal of Pharmacology, Archives of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ation and Thermochimica Acta.
